Rocks go through a cycle called the rock cycle. The rock cycle is a cycle in which rocks change into other rocks. A sedimentary rock can go through heat and pressure to create a metamorphic rock. Rocks, however don't just change into another rock and stay that way. Rocks go through the rock cycle many times. The rock cycle may be confusing, but rocks can change very easily. An Igneous rock might go through weathering and erosion. If this happens, a igneous rock turns into a Sedimentary rock! That same sedimentary rock goes through hat and pressure underground, that rock is now a Metamorphic rock. Again, that same metamorphic rock starts melting, and then cools, and creates a Igneous rock. This process though and take Millions of years.
